Distance from Casasimarro to Shanghai

The distance between Casasimarro, Spain and Shanghai, China is 10,259 kilometers (6,374 miles).

Casasimarro, Castille-La Mancha, Spain

Shanghai, China

From Casasimarro to Shanghai, the straight-line distance is 10,259 kilometers, heading northeast. Casasimarro is situated at an altitude of 768 meters above sea level, while Shanghai is at only 12 meters.

Travel time

Mode Estimated time
Airplane 16-18 hours
Speed Time
Casasimarro, Spain

Local time:

Time Zone: Europe/Madrid

Coordinates: 39.3667° N 2.0333° W

Elevation: 768 m (2,520 ft)


Nearby airports:
  • Albacete-Los Llanos Airport (ABC)
  • Valencia Airport (VLC)
  • Teruel Airport (TEV)
  • Torrejón Airport (TOJ)
  • Alicante International Airport (ALC)
Shanghai, China

Local time:

Time Zone: Asia/Shanghai

Coordinates: 31.2222° N 121.4581° E

Elevation: 12 m (39 ft)


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Casasimarro

Distance between cities Kilometers
From Casasimarro to Madrid 184 km
From Casasimarro to Barcelona 421 km
From Casasimarro to Valencia 143 km
From Casasimarro to Zaragoza 272 km
From Casasimarro to Málaga 361 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Chengdu 1,661 km
From Shanghai to Tianjin 961 km
From Shanghai to Wuhan 691 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Casasimarro and Shanghai.

From To Distance (kilometers)
Baghdad, Iraq Milwaukee, United States 10,259 km
Istanbul, Turkey Valledupar, Colombia 10,259 km
Rome, Italy Iztacalco, Mexico 10,259 km
Baghdad, Iraq Columbus, United States 10,259 km
Rome, Italy Iztapalapa, Mexico 10,259 km
Rome, Italy Cuauhtémoc, Mexico 10,258 km
Tegucigalpa, Honduras Belgrade, Serbia 10,260 km
Rome, Italy Mexico City, Mexico 10,258 km
Brasília, Brazil Surrey, Canada 10,260 km
Rome, Italy Azcapotzalco, Mexico 10,258 km
Kyiv, Ukraine San Diego, United States 10,260 km
Istanbul, Turkey Goiânia, Brazil 10,258 km
Kinshasa, Democratic Republic of the Congo Brooklyn, United States 10,260 km
Rome, Italy Ciudad López Mateos, Mexico 10,257 km
Managua, Nicaragua Port Harcourt, Nigeria 10,261 km
Arequipa, Peru Newcastle upon Tyne, United Kingdom 10,261 km
Vancouver, Canada Shenzhen, China 10,257 km
Sheffield, United Kingdom Asunción, Paraguay 10,256 km
Rome, Italy Santiago de Querétaro, Mexico 10,256 km
Shenzhen, China Zaragoza, Spain 10,256 km

Measure more distances between cities